James A.
Cochran formerly worked at Delta Apparel, Inc., as Independent Director from 2011 to 2015, TurboChef Technologies, Inc., as SVP-Investor Relations & Corporate Strategies in 2009, VitalWorks, Inc., as Chief Financial Officer from 1999 to 2001, PracticeWorks, Inc., as Chief Financial Officer & Senior Vice President from 2000 to 2003, Greenway Health, Inc., as Chief Financial Officer from 2009 to 2015, and BDO USA PC, as Partner in 1999.
Mr. Cochran received his undergraduate degree and Masters Business Admin degree from Georgia State University.

TurboChef Technologies, Inc.
TurboChef Technologies, Inc. Electronics/AppliancesConsumer Durables The Group's principal activities are to design, develop and market proprietary cooking systems. These technologies provide foodservice operators the flexibility to cook-to-order a variety of foods items at speed, which are faster than those permitted by conventional commercial ovens. The proprietary systems include TurboCom, a centralized cook setting system, which, through the use of a computer modem, can reprogram TurboChef ovens installed in various restaurant locations from a single central site.
